2006 - 2007
Tax year begins July 1

Tax Rate per $100 of Value: $0.36
The Code of Virginia provides for the assessment of real estate taxes based on fair market value.
       
Real estate is assessed on July 1st each year by the Commissioner of Revenue.
       
Real estate tax bills are provided to mortgage companies that provide written requests.

Each landowner in Mecklenburg County should have a Deed recorded in the Clerk of Court's Office. The information contained on the Deed is used by the Commissioner of the Revenue's Office to determine ownership and assess value to the land and any improvements thereon.

Once each year, the Commssioner of the Revenue prints a Land Book detailing the assessed value of land and improvements within the County.

The Land Book information is passed along to the Treasurer's Office which is responsible for the billing and collection of tax.
